| CVE-2019-11408 | 1 Fusionpbx | 1 Fusionpbx | 2019-06-18 | 4.3 MEDIUM | 6.1 MEDIUM |
| XSS in app/operator_panel/index_inc.php in the Operator Panel module in FusionPBX 4.4.3 allows remote unauthenticated attackers to inject arbitrary JavaScript characters by placing a phone call using a specially crafted caller ID number. This can further lead to remote code execution by chaining this vulnerability with a command injection vulnerability also present in FusionPBX. | |||||
